Output ac1af651aadd6bf9a44603b73f28b7728939c353c60ee1aceb63af19a5b9f42e:1

value
20131982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ec8c2bbaf9683725678bee92e8eb88b69f4c4a41 OP_EQUAL
address
3PFmK49qgCC3Ejj3rX5V4n9xirUyz1JSGo
transaction
ac1af651aadd6bf9a44603b73f28b7728939c353c60ee1aceb63af19a5b9f42e
confirmations
269972
spent
true